首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何在WSO2应用编程接口管理器3.2.0上启用SCIM2

WSO2应用编程接口管理器(API Manager)是一个开源的API管理平台,用于管理和监控企业内外的API。SCIM(System for Cross-domain Identity Management)是一种用于标准化身份管理的协议,它可以帮助实现用户和组织之间的身份数据交换。

要在WSO2 API Manager 3.2.0上启用SCIM2,需要按照以下步骤进行操作:

  1. 下载和安装WSO2 API Manager 3.2.0:你可以从WSO2官方网站(https://wso2.com/api-management/)上下载最新版本的API Manager,并按照官方文档进行安装。
  2. 配置SCIM2模块:打开API Manager的安装目录,找到repository/deployment/server目录下的axis2.xml文件。使用文本编辑器打开该文件,并找到以下行:
代码语言:txt
复制
<module ref="identity.scim2.module"/>

如果找不到该行,可以在文件中的<modules>标签内添加上述行。保存并关闭文件。

  1. 配置用户存储:在API Manager的安装目录下,找到repository/conf/user-mgt.xml文件,使用文本编辑器打开该文件。找到以下行:
代码语言:txt
复制
<UserStoreManager class="org.wso2.carbon.user.core.jdbc.JDBCUserStoreManager">

在上述行之后添加以下配置信息:

代码语言:txt
复制
<Property name="SCIMEnabled">true</Property>

保存并关闭文件。

  1. 启动API Manager:通过命令行或启动脚本启动WSO2 API Manager。

完成以上步骤后,SCIM2将在WSO2 API Manager 3.2.0上启用。你可以使用SCIM2协议来管理API Manager中的用户和组织身份数据。SCIM2具有以下优势和应用场景:

优势:

  • 标准化的身份管理协议,方便与其他身份管理系统进行集成。
  • 提供了通用的API和数据模型,减少了开发和维护成本。
  • 支持用户和组织的增删改查操作,方便管理用户身份和权限。

应用场景:

  • 身份管理:通过SCIM2协议,可以实现用户和组织的身份管理,包括用户的创建、更新、删除和查询等操作。
  • 协同工作:可以通过SCIM2来实现用户和组织之间的数据共享和协作,提高团队的工作效率。
  • 合作伙伴管理:通过SCIM2可以实现与合作伙伴之间的用户数据交换,方便管理外部合作伙伴的身份和权限。

腾讯云提供了一系列与API管理相关的产品,可以帮助企业快速搭建和管理API,具体推荐的产品如下:

  • API网关:腾讯云API网关(https://cloud.tencent.com/product/apigateway)是一款高性能、高可用、可扩展的API网关产品,可帮助企业对API进行统一管理和安全控制。
  • 云身份与访问管理(CAM):腾讯云CAM(https://cloud.tencent.com/product/cam)是一款可托管和集中管理用户身份和访问权限的产品,可与API网关集成,实现身份和权限的统一管理。

以上是关于如何在WSO2应用编程接口管理器3.2.0上启用SCIM2的完善且全面的答案。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的视频

领券